Description: Mushroom House in New York, also known as the Pod House, is an iconic and whimsical architectural marvel located in the town of Perinton, near Rochester. Designed by architect James H. Johnson in the early 1970s, this unique residence features a series of interconnected, pod-like structures that resemble mushrooms, giving it a fairytale-like appearance. The house is constructed with a combination of concrete and stucco, and its organic, flowing forms blend seamlessly with the surrounding wooded landscape. Over the years, the Mushroom House has become a local landmark and a testament to innovative, nature-inspired design.
